Basketball Recap: Maize Eagles vs. Heights Falcons

It's playoff time, and Maize had no trouble coming through when it counted. They managed a 57-52 victory over the Heights Falcons on Saturday. This was a revenge game for the Eagles: when they faced off against the Falcons back in January, they had to take a 66-49 loss.

Alan Hanna continued his habit of posting crazy stat lines, shooting 59% from the field to rack up 24 points and five blocks. Those five blocks gave him a new career-high. The team also got some help courtesy of Brayden Myovela, who posted nine points in addition to seven assists and seven rebounds.

Maize was working as a unit and finished the game with 22 assists. They easily outclassed their opponents in that department as Heights only seven assists.

Heights' defeat came despite a true team effort with many players turning in solid performances. Perhaps the best among them was Amalachi Wilkins, who almost dropped a double-double with nine points and 11 boards. Wilkins is also on a roll when it comes to blocks, as he's now posted two or more in each of the last four games he's played. Chase Robinson was another key player, going 6-for-7 en route to 12 points.

Maize is on a roll lately: they've won 11 of their last 13 matches. That's provided a nice bump to their 18-7 record this season. The wins came thanks in part to their offensive performance across that stretch, as they averaged 66.5 points over those games. This is the second loss in a row for Heights and nudges their season record down to 21-4.

As of now, neither Maize nor Heights have any future games scheduled.
